Video – BMW M6 Gran Coupe vs Audi RS7

This is the new Audi RS7 and its arch-rival, the BMW M6 Gran Coupe. Both are powered by turbocharged V8 engines and have over 500bhp -but do they really justify their price tags? Watch this video review to find out.

The BMW M6 features a 4.4-litre twin-turbo V8 with 552bhp and 680Nm of torque. It’ll sprint from 0-60 in just 4.2 seconds before hitting a limited top speed of 155mph. The Audi has a 4.0-litre twin-turbo V8 yet despite being down on capacity compared to the BMW it produces the same bhp and has even more torque with a huge 700Nm. Once again top speed is limited to 155mph, but it hits 60 in just 3.9 seconds.

Overall, the BMW engine has a little bit more character than the Audi engine and there’s certainly more fizz to the driving experience. It’s not perfect and it troubles the traction control quite a lot on a wet road, though. The BMW is the best to drive but it’s also the nicest to sit in, with its stylish interior and sporty wrap-around cockpit. It might cost a lot more money than the BMW M5 but they decided to go for the M6 Gran Coupe – it looks great, sounds fantastic and most importantly it’s more fun to drive than the Audi RS7.
